Stafflex is seeking enthusiastic and energetic Playworkers to join our team, providing engaging and supportive play opportunities for children in Huddersfield and surrounding areas. The role involves working before and after school hours, helping to create a fun and stimulating environment in Out of school club settings.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Plan and lead activities that engage children in a variety of creative and recreational play.
  • Ensure a safe, inclusive, and welcoming environment for all children.
  • Supervise children during play times, supporting their social, emotional, and physical development.
  • Maintain effective communication with children, parents, and colleagues.
  • Adhere to health and safety guidelines, safeguarding procedures, and club policies.

Requirements:

  • Experience working with children, preferably in an Out of school club or childcare setting
  • A positive, energetic attitude with the ability to engage children in a range of activities
  • Minimum of a level 2 qualification in Supporting Teaching and Learning in Schools
  • Maths and English qualification of Level 2 or above
  • Strong communication and teamwork skills
  • Ability to manage groups of children and handle various situations calmly.
  • An enhanced DBS check registered with the DBS Update Service, or willingness to obtain one
